Output 91b58123d24e293f6b1e92d5b526acf2b017fc1b605a7c2ed50cda2bd4adf6cf:0

value
233781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1db5527508f8284c3db516dc24c46d749b84bc8f OP_EQUAL
address
34Q6jb1EYC9VuxdvwiDtduwxi2hFVcYQMv
transaction
91b58123d24e293f6b1e92d5b526acf2b017fc1b605a7c2ed50cda2bd4adf6cf
confirmations
444186
spent
true